County Board declares ‘disaster’

Big drifts and one-lane roads, like this example west of Albion, are common in Boone County.Boone County Commissioners on Tuesday approved a declaration of disaster for the county in the wake of blizzards causing excessive snow removal and maintenance costs for the period of Dec. 22, 2009 to Jan. 6, 2010.

The county declaration will be forwarded to the Nebraska Emergency Management Agency, and the county could be eligible for reimbursement of some extra costs if a statewide disaster is declared.

County Emergency Manager Mike Thiem and County Highway Superintendent Darrel Thorin provided an initial estimate of $130,000 for county expenses during the 16-day period.

Most of the additional cost is for snow removal on county roads, which includes labor, equipment use, fuel costs and repairs.
